Del caos al cosmos: una nueva serie enlazada del Producto Interior Bruto de España entre 1850 y 2000

Author

Listed:
  • JORDI MALUQUER DE MOTES

    (Universidad Autonoma de Barcelona)

Abstract

El propósito de este trabajo consiste en construir una nueva y más sólida estimación de la serie del Producto Interior Bruto de España desde 1850 a 2000. El artículo resume la historia de la Contabilidad Nacional en el país y revisa la elaboración de las cuentas nacionales históricas. Además, analiza los posibles errores e inconsistencias de los datos existentes. Demuestra que no hay razón alguna para desechar las estimaciones oficiales, sino que, por el contrario, deben incorporarse salvando adecuadamente los problemas de falta de homogeneidad. Expone, por último, la metodología utilizada para construir nuevas series del PIB y del PIB per cápita para todo el período. Los nuevos datos suponen importantes correcciones al alza de las cuentas nacionales anteriores a 1954, al tiempo que resultan coherentes con las series de carácter oficial enlazadas. Por tanto, la interpretación de algunos períodos de la historia económica española debe ser sustancialmente modificada.
